Scaffolding Safety Tips for Nigeria's Rainy Season
3 July 20251 min read
Rainy season in Nigeria means slippery work environments, strong winds, and increased risk for scaffold-related accidents. It's not just about delays — it's about protecting lives.
Key Safety Tips:
- ✔️ Always inspect for rust or loose joints before each use
- ✔️ Avoid using scaffolds during heavy rain or thunderstorms
- ✔️ Install anti-slip planks and proper drainage under the scaffold
- ✔️ Ensure guardrails and toe boards are always in place
